Marks and Spencer in Liverpool is seeking a Customer Assistant to join our Food section. In this role, you will be at the frontline of providing exceptional service, recommending food products, and supporting a vibrant team.
Candidates must be 18 or older, possess digital confidence, and work effectively under pressure to ensure customer satisfaction. Flexibility is essential, with specific shifts on weekends. An unsocial hours premium applies for work during specified late hours.

How to prepare for a job interview at Marks and Spencer
✨Know Your Products
Familiarise yourself with Marks and Spencer's food offerings. Be ready to discuss your favourite products and why you think they stand out. This shows your passion for the brand and helps you connect with customers.
✨Showcase Your Customer Service Skills
Prepare examples of how you've provided excellent customer service in the past. Think about situations where you went above and beyond to help a customer, as this will demonstrate your commitment to customer satisfaction.
✨Emphasise Flexibility
Since the role requires flexibility, be prepared to discuss your availability. Highlight your willingness to work weekends and late hours, as this will show that you're a reliable team player who can adapt to the needs of the business.
✨Stay Calm Under Pressure
Think of scenarios where you've successfully managed stress or high-pressure situations. Share these experiences during the interview to illustrate your ability to maintain composure and deliver great service, even when things get busy.
